66问答网
所有问题
C语言得到的数保留两位小数应该怎么写语句?
如题所述
举报该问题
其他回答
第1个回答 2019-07-02
如果需要保留2位小数,那么就要在输出函数printf函数中规定输出格式了。
具体格式如下:
printf("%.2f"); // 使输出的数按四舍五入的准则保留2位小数,不足2位就在后面补0
更一般的表示如下:
printf("%a.bf"); // 其中a, b都表示整数。输出格式如下:
// 整数部分按a位的固定位宽输出(不足a位就在前面补空格,大于a位就按实际位数输出)
// 小数部分按四舍五入的准则保留b位小数(不足b位就在后面补0)
相似回答
C语言中怎样保留2位小数?
答:
c语言保留2位小数
可用%.2f字符。
c语言保留两位小数
可用%.2f字符,结果就能输出两位小数,记忆方法:点.后面一个2,表示小数点后保留两位。c语言之C++保留两位小数代码:第一种写法cout<<setiosflags(ios::fixed)<<setprecision(2);第二种写法cout.setf(ios::fixed);cout<<setprecision(2);第三种写法c...
c语言中如何保留两位小数?
答:
用
C语言的
方法:输入printf("%5.2f",a),其中5表示宽度,2就是精度,即
保留两位小数
。2.设置小数位数法:cout<<setiosflags(ios::fixed)<<setprecision(2);当setiosflags(ios::fixed)和serprecision(n)两个一起用时就表示保留n位小数输出。这里还要注意,每次输出只要设置一次就行了,因为这两个的...
c语言如何
让输出结果精确到
两位小数
答:
C语言中
浮点数输出精确到
两位小数的语句
如下 double a=2.0;printf ("%.2f", a);//其中.2指明两位小数 说明:如%9.2f 表示输出场宽为9的浮点数, 其中小数位为2, 整数位为6,如果9缺省则场宽为该数实际位数 规定符 d 十进制有符号整数 u 十进制无符号整数 f 浮点数 s 字符串 c 单个字...
c语言中怎么保留小数2位
答:
在C语言中,
可以使用printf函数的格式化输出功能来保留小数后两位
。例如:printf。这样输出的浮点数会保留两位小数。详细解释:1. 格式化输出:在C语言中,printf函数用于格式化输出。这意味着你可以指定输出的格式,包括整数、浮点数等的数据类型和显示方式。对于浮点数,可以使用特定的格式控制符来保留小数...
c语言中保留两位小数怎么
表示
答:
保留两位小数
: %.2f
c语言保留两位小数怎么保留
答:
a,b;a=1.123456;b=2.324855;printf(“%lf,%lfn”,a,b);return0;}。4、编写完之后,点击右上角的叹号,运行这个程序。5、然后我们就可以看到后面显示了6位小数。6、接着将刚刚的那个程序里面的%lf改成%.2lf即可。7、运行这个修改后的程序之后,就可以看到后面
保留小数2位
。
大家正在搜
C语言保留两位小数怎么保留
c语言怎么保留一位小数
c语言中怎么保留3位小数
c语言中保留两位小数
c语言计算结果保留两位小数
c语言中两位小数怎么输入
c语言小数点后保留两位
c语言中怎样输出两位小数
c语言保留三位小数